Refined limiting imbeddings for Sobolev spaces of vector-valued functions
The authors consider vector-valued Sobolev, Besov, and Triebel-Lizorkin spaces of functions with values in a general Banach space; in general, these spaces may lack the UMD property. The authors prove a refined limiting embedding theorem of the Brézis-Wainger type in the critical case. The main result reads as follows: Theorem 3.

On stable refinable function vectors with arbitrary support
This paper studies the stability property of a refinable function vector in the space of \(L^2\) using the transfer operator (also called the transition operator in the literature of wavelets). Generalizing a result of Gundy from scalar refinable functions to refinable function vectors, under conditions such as the existence of a refinable function ...
